Abstract
We have developed a wireless communication holder system to monitor various physical quantities during processing in multiple channels. This holder system was shown to be effective for estimating the processing temperature in end-milling and the vibration in radial and axial directions in boring of rotating machining tools. We have implemented a function for monitoring tool rotational direction in this holder system, to explore the processing phenomenon in end-milling and tapping. This report presents the effectiveness of this holder system.
